Output b4f8a93e5edc35b1cadf64e3115b7646e0af2a316e8f75fc73274a7e10d11de7:2

value
103642565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db663a4d46821dcdbc5c7b4e6c58dd778e99bb52 OP_EQUAL
address
MTuEgMCVahuABis97a5MfSRxAghLuigYan
transaction
b4f8a93e5edc35b1cadf64e3115b7646e0af2a316e8f75fc73274a7e10d11de7
spent
true